Contribution of pks+ E. coli mutations to colorectal carcinogenesis.
Nature communications - 29 Nov 2023
Chen Bingjie, Ramazzotti Daniele, Heide Timon, Spiteri Inmaculada, Fernandez-Mateos Javier, James Chela, Magnani Luca, Graham Trevor A, Sottoriva Andrea
Abstract excerpt
The dominant mutational signature in colorectal cancer genomes is C > T deamination (COSMIC Signature 1) and, in a small subgroup, mismatch repair signature (COSMIC signatures 6 and 44). Mutations in common colorectal cancer driver genes are often not consistent with those signatures.
